Mr. Harry W Low New York

Dear Sir

Mr. Henry A. Rice Proprietor of
the Lot adjoining yours in the Cemetery has applied
to us to trim the branches of the Tree that over-
hangs his lot. Upon examination it is found
that the tree he refers to is situate in the center
of your lot No 2306 Pilgrim P. The Tree being
an American Willow the Gardener thinks that it would
hardly prove a benefit and might be detrimental to
the tree to trim it. The grass in both your own
and Mr Rice's lots suffers from the presence of the
Tree. These being the main points in the case
please inform me of your wishes in the matter

An answer as soon as practicable would confer a
favor on yours

Very Respectfully

James W Lovering Supt

per Childs
